A new study shows that adding black raspberries may be protective for patients with GERD who advance to have Barretts Esophagus. The chronic acid damage in the esophagus from GERD- gastroesophageal reflux disease, can cause changes in the lining called Barrett's esophagus, which is precancerous. Laura Kresty, PhD.
